It is back to league action for both sides next. Wolves head to Everton on Boxing day in a key clash at the bottom of the Premier League whilst Gillingham are at home to Colchester in League Two.
Second-half goals from Jimenez and Ait Nouri are enough for Wolves as they beat Gillingham 2-0 at home to secure their place in the EFL Cup quarter-finals. After a quiet first half, the home side eventually sprung into life midway through the second period. Hwang was brought down by Alexander in the box from a corner, with subsitute Jimenez stepping up to convert the penalty. Then, in extra time, as Gillingham pressed forward for the equaliser, fellow substitute Ait Nouri was able to put the game to bed wth a calm finish to seal the win for Wolves.

Gillingham are looking to reach the EFL Cup quarter-final for the first time – seven of their last 10 matches in the competition have gone to a penalty shootout.
Neil Harris makes three changes to his Gillingham side that beat Dagenham & Redbridge in the FA Cup. In defence, Alexander comes intoto replace Green whilst in midfield O'Keefe replaces Reeves. Up front, Mandron returns to the side instead of Walker with early signs suggesting Gillingham will move to a back five for this encounter.
For the home side, there are four changes from their friendly victory against Cadiz. Sa comes in to replace Sarkic in goal. Elsewhere Ait Nouri, Toti and Traore also make way for Bueno, Neves and Guedes.

Gillingham, who sit bottom of League Two, haven't play in two weeks either due to postponments. Their last fixture was a 3-2 victory against Dagenham & Redbridge in an FA Cup second-round replay.
It feels like years ago that these sides were drawn to face each other in the EFL Cup round of 16. Wolves, as with all Premier League clubs, have not played a competitive game throughout the World Cup but most recently beat Cadiz 4-3 in a friendly match.
